Across TCGA patient cohorts, P3H2 mutation is significantly associated with the total protein of many other genes, with 39 significant associations in total. UCEC shows the largest number of these associations.

The most reproducible P3H2-associated genes across cancer lineages are Rb_pS807_S811, Caspase-8, and c-Kit. Each is linked with P3H2 in more than 1 cancer types. Because this analysis shows association rather than direction, both P3H2-to-partner and partner-to-P3H2 results are reported.
